CRC XD8 Biodegradable Cleaner Degreaser 500ml CRC XD8 Biodegradable Cleaner Degreaser ...
CRC XD8 is an industrial strength citrus-based cleaner and degreaser formulated for powerful natural cleaning in industrial applications. The natural d-Limonene oil penetrates and lifts contaminants from surfaces, leaving them clean with no oily...